ORDINANCE NO. 706
AN ORDINANCE RELATING TO THE ESTABLISHMENT OF A SIDEWALK
GRADE ON THE WEST SIDE OF KINGSBURY AVENUE IN THE THIRD WARD.
BE IT ORDAINED BY TH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F AMES, IOWA:
Section 1. All grade elevations given in this Ordinance shall be
determined with reference to the City Datum Plane.
Section 2. All grade elevations given in this Ordinance are for the
top of the sidewalk on the ;Vest side of Kingsbury Avenue.
Section 3. Sidewalk grade for the West Side of Kingsbury Avenue
South from Lincoln Way 326 feet:
Sidewalk Grade
Station 04 00 South Line Lincoln Way 93.00
0 + 50 97.00
1 + 50 98.00
2 � 00 97.00
2 f 50 96.00
2 + 62 95.76
3 + 00 92.72
3 + 26 90.64
Passed this 23rd day of October, 1951.
